Chapter 302 – Know My Truth

Akin’s POV:

“Beatrice! Just tell me, where are you?” I asked her again, holding the letter and crumbling it in my tight

fist.

“I can’t. I am leaving,” she said from the other side.

“Why didn’t you ever tell me?” I asked while trying to keep my cool. I had to walk out of the mansion in

a hurry to stand on the road away from everyone to hold my tension in when I was talking to her. I am

sure anybody who sees me now can tell I am stressed.

“You hate our kind,” she scoffed. Just the thought of her being a weredragon gave me anxiety. How did

I never see it?

‘Because we trusted her wholeheartedly,’ King said, after being sad about the fact she hadn’t told us

anything in so many days.

“And that gave you every right to deceive me?” I couldn’t keep my voice low anymore. She sounded so

blunt and careless as if hiding her truth from me was the right thing to do.

“I am sorry. Akin. But you shouldn’t be questioning me when your parents should be the ones held

accountable for what I did. I couldn’t tell you the truth because I knew what you all would do to me. Do

you not remember Colt? You guys were not even letting him say his side or —give him a chance to

prove himself to be a good person. Just our kind was enough reason for you guys to end his life,” I

noticed her voice shaking a little and she was also sniffling a lot.

‘She is crying!’ King sighed, obviously melting.

“Then why now?” I asked.novelbin

“Ask your mother. She threatened to expose me and get me punished if I didn’t leave. But then I found

out that the driver she has arranged for me is a hunter. He would kill me after taking me far away from

the population. That was your mother’s plan,” she was murmuring in soft whispers.

“My mother—,” I was shocked that so much was happening behind my back and that I didn’t get to

hear about it until now.

“I am not surprised because I know soon everybody will be after me—,” she paused as we both heard

the same announcement from before. It was the second time that they played this announcement over

the speakers.

“Oh!” She let me know she was hearing the announcement.

“It is not going to stop, and neither are my guards going to, until you tell me where you are,” I told her

without trying to sugarcoat it.

“I am sorry,” she whispered, and then she hung up on me.

“F*UC*K!” I cussed, briskly walking back into the mansion to reach for the attic and see if I could find

her in the cameras.

“Beatrice ran away?” Dad was talking to my mom when I heard their conversation when walking past

the living room.

“My jewelry is also missing,” mom sighed dramatically.

“Akin!” While standing there and listening to them, I was joined by Zane, who had just returned from

Goddess knows where.

“I heard the announcement. What happened?” He seemed worried. Wait till he hears that we have

been keeping a weredragon in our mansion for so long.

“She is gone,” I said, tightly holding the paper in my hand and not letting it go.

“But what happened?’ Zane kept following me until we were in the attic, “I heard the announcements

too.”

“Then start looking for her,” I said without getting deeper into the conversation. Zane understood and

started the cameras. We spent a few minutes on the screen, and I found her.

“She is by the train station,” Zane whispered under his breath, watching my face to see what I would do

next.

I grabbed my phone and told my guards to stop her. While they were on their way, I also got up to find

her.

“I am coming with you,” Zane argued when I told him to follow me. We silently walked up to our cars

before I looked his way and said, “Speak to mom. She will tell you what’s going on.”

Zane looked shocked but nodded, and instead of going back home, he still followed me.

“Zane!” I frowned angrily, “Go back inside,” I yelled, but he shook his head and gestured at me to keep

going.

I didn’t want him to tag along, but now that he was being stubborn, I had no choice but to get inside my

car and start the journey to catch the weredragon.

I had a lot going on in my head, but I kept my l*ips sealed. Even King refused to comment on this

situation anymore. I received a call after a few minutes from my guards that they caught her, but she

was being difficult, so now they were surrounding her and making sure she didn’t get away from them.

Once we reached the station, we both got out of our cars. I took the lead while Zane didn’t argue. My

heart was pounding at the moment. I made my way to the rail and found her standing between the

guards and looking agitated.

She was freaking out, and rightfully so. She stopped moving when her eyes landed on me. I saw the

fear of her heart breaking from even afar.

“What is going on?” Zane must have noticed that it wasn’t only about her running away and that there

was more to the story.

“Everybody out. Leave her for me,” I declared in my loud, commanding voice. She was staring at me

with her big, shining eyes and innocent face.

That innocent face never let me question anything she told me about her wolf, but now everything was

beginning to make sense.

She straightened her posture and kept looking my way.

“Fine. You won!” She scoffed and shook her head while clenching her jaw.

“No! you don’t get to talk tonight,” I warned her, walking in her direction and keeping a sharp gaze on

her face. “I will talk tonight,” I reached her and stood face-to-face, ready to do something I never

expected of myself.
